(Yesterday, 5:18)Peter Blomberg Wrote: As an inexperienced user, I find the (Needs Work) confusing in the description. If a part needs work, why has it been approved into the library?

On the other hand, there are a lot of parts that would need to be updated for one reason or another; e.g. orientation, use of primitives, height of origin, etc. However, these tend to not be known at the time the part is being edited and would have to be amended to parts already in the library.

A big chunk of the parts carrying the "needs work" is more or less irrelevant to the user.

If I scan the official parts, I get 271:
  • around 30 concern a "missing proper fallback texture for a texmap"
  • as Magnus mentioned, another 50 or so are stickers where a comment is there, where a dithered area has been designed in a effcicent way
  • Many part are missing interior, which is absolutely no deal if this is a (glued/fixed) assembly, you can discuss that interior of parts that CAN be taken apart, e.g. boat parts where the connection of the hull and the deck is not designed, should keep this information (probably yes)
  • Only a few are really "visible" to the enduser, i.e. were the outside is affected, e.g. the zip line hook 30229


concerning the second part of your post, orientation and origin, I would rather abstain from obsoleting parts due to their orientation, they might not fit into their realm, but that generates a lot of a/b/c versions that (however less we say we care) don'T kmatch the BL or RB descriptions/designid.
Even LEGO itselft rotates parts around, e.g. the new mudguard, 6618, is upside down compared to the others when I look at the raw mesh.
